When I run whois google.com, it shows following name servers:
Name Server: ns2.google.com
Name Server: ns4.google.com
Name Server: ns3.google.com
Name Server: ns1.google.com
So my question is, where is the source of this data? Can I make some kind of request (http/tcp/udp etc.) to get it directly from the "source", without doing whois command?
